Description
The film shows the use and manipulation of stiff and disabled joints. A medical illustration with captions comprises of a hand drawn image of a limb joint clearly pinned to a notice board. A patient with tuberculosis knee is shown unable to flex their leg fully; an x-ray reveals the damage to the bones. A patient is anaesthetised and has their limbs manipulated and also a Faradic charge applied. All patients are unrecognisable except for one woman who is briefly shown with her arm being flexed above her head.
